John Lydon, better known by his stage name Johnny Rotten, is a British-American musician, singer, songwriter, and cultural icon best known as the frontman of the punk band the Sex Pistols. Born on January 31, 1956, in London, England, Lydon’s upbringing in a working-class Irish immigrant family deeply influenced his rebellious nature and outlook on society. He rose to fame in the 1970s as the face of the punk rock movement, particularly with his distinctive voice, provocative persona, and anti-establishment lyrics. His work with the Sex Pistols from 1975 to 1978 produced punk rock anthems like “Anarchy in the U.K.” and “God Save the Queen,” songs that challenged authority and criticized the British monarchy, striking a nerve in a society dealing with economic strife and social unrest.

Lydon’s influence extended beyond the Sex Pistols. After the band’s dissolution, he formed Public Image Ltd (PiL), a post-punk band that allowed him to explore more experimental sounds, blending elements of rock, reggae, and electronic music. PiL’s work, particularly in albums like Metal Box (1979), showcased Lydon’s versatility and innovation, marking a significant shift from his punk roots. This new direction allowed him to build a career that spanned decades, including several PiL reunions and tours.

Known for his outspoken and often controversial opinions, Lydon has remained a prominent figure in pop culture. He often appears on television and in interviews, where he continues to voice his thoughts on politics, music, and society. His 1993 autobiography, Rotten: No Irish, No Blacks, No Dogs, details his life, his challenging childhood, his rise to fame, and his complex relationship with fame and the punk movement.

Rise To Fame

John Lydon, also known as Johnny Rotten, is a music icon whose journey to fame began in the mid-1970s. He became a symbol of punk rock and rebellion.

Joining The Sex Pistols

John Lydon joined the Sex Pistols in 1975. This was a pivotal moment in his career. The band’s music was raw and controversial.

Their debut single, “Anarchy in the U.K.,” was a hit. It put them on the map. The Sex Pistols released their only studio album, “Never Mind the Bollocks, Here’s the Sex Pistols,” in 1977.

This album solidified the band’s place in punk rock history, and the band’s success contributed significantly to John’s net worth.

Public Image Limited

After the Sex Pistols disbanded, John formed Public Image Limited (PiL) in 1978. PiL’s music differed from Sex Pistols’: it was more experimental and post-punk.

Their debut album, “First Issue,” was well-received and showcased John’s versatility as an artist. PiL had several successful albums, including “Metal Box” and “Album.”
